Tara Nouveau (our Head of AI Learning Products) and Khe Hy (founder of Latour AI) pour some cold water on seven of the hottest takes on AI.
The real difference between an agent and an automation, and why getting it wrong turns a time-saver into more work.
AI speeds up the doing and hands you more to decide. Why the heaviest AI users are more drained than ever, and the skill of knowing what's actually worth handing off.
Foundational building skills, yes. Everyone rebuilding the CRM, no. Boundary literacy, and why some problems that look like AI problems are work problems.
AI reads medical scans better than radiologists, and there's still a shortage of them. When AI takes over the rote task, the role usually expands and moves up the value chain instead of disappearing.


Tara Nouveau is a behavioral scientist and learning architect with 15+ years designing programs that change what people do, not just what they know. Trained in biostatistics and published in peer-reviewed journals, she pairs scientific rigor with hands-on AI fluency. At Clarinet, she built the company's first standalone product, the AI Fluency Assessment, and the proprietary frameworks at the core of its workshops. Previously, she led LifeLabs Learning programs reaching 150,000+ leaders at organizations including Google, Airbnb, and Impossible Foods.
